Sunday, May 2, 1999

Foreign SEs to allow Indian terminals
The stage is set for Indian stock exchanges to set up trading terminals overseas with foreign stock market regulators expressing their willingness to allow trading in Indian markets from abroad.

Exports show good growth in March
After a dismal performance during the first half of the 1998-99 fiscal, India's exports recorded a double digit growth for the first time in March with 10.07 per cent rise enabling cumulative exports growth of 3.7 per cent.

Indian auto policy -- US to move WTO
The United States on Saturday said it would haul India to the World Trade Organisation (WTO) over New Delhi's auto policy.
